**Mgmt Meeting Minutes — Retiring the Brightline Range**

Quick recap for sales leads at Fenholt Supplies: we agreed to retire the Brightline fixture range by year-end. Remaining stock moves to clearance pricing next month, and accounts on standing orders get migrated to the Lumetta range. Trade-in incentives were approved in principle. The confidential note on next steps sits just below.

board note of bajof-bajeg: The pricing group signed off on a budget of $13.4 million for Project Sildor. The renewal with Lamixek Holdings closes at $48.9 million a year, 49 percent above the last contract.

## Changelog — Tallyframe 4.2.0

Changed: report sorting is now stable by default. Previously, rows with equal sort keys could be reordered between runs because the builder used an unstable quicksort. Tallyframe now falls back to insertion order as a tiebreaker, which may shift output for reports that relied on the old behavior. Reviewers should confirm downstream diffs are expected. The defaults shipped with this release are listed below.

service settings:
druath:
  pin: 7832
  metrics_host: metrics.druath.tolvaqlabs.internal
  tenant: eliix
  seal: seal_01c421e1

Handover — Formulant sandbox. Support team: user-supplied formulas now run in the new isolate pool. Timeouts set at 2s; anything longer gets killed and logged. Known issue: nested imports still bypass the allowlist on tenant workspaces created before March — escalate those, don't retry. Quota errors are usually just the pool scaling; wait five minutes. Debug console is behind the sandbox vault since last week's incident. If you need to inspect a killed formula, open the vault with the recovery passphrase below.

unlock words, kajef-kadug: sorys-pelax-lamael-tamvan-briiel-novdor-fenwyn-tamdor-oliion-keleth-julok-belion-ralok

Migration step 4 — snapshot tests for Plover UI

Quick one for the sync: we're moving the Plover component library off the old pixel-diff harness onto tree snapshots. Delete the stale golden images first, or the runner will flag them as orphans and fail the build. Re-record snapshots locally before pushing — CI won't auto-update them anymore. Once recorded, point the test runner at the new harness using these settings.

settings of fafog-haduf:
ZORIX_PIN=4648
ZORIX_METRICS_HOST=metrics.zorix.paliqsys.corp
ZORIX_LOG_LEVEL=info
ZORIX_TENANT=druix